Fee

The complexity of an accident case and the expertise of the attorney will determine the fee. A higher rate usually indicates a seasoned lawyer with a better track record. The fees will be laid out in the fee agreement. The majority of attorneys will charge between 3 and 40% of the settlement amount. The amount can vary, though, depending on the laws of the state and ethics rules for lawyers.

After an accident, medical treatment is crucial for the health of the victim, and the cost of care can be huge. The medical bills could continue for months, if not even years. This is a very unfair situation for the patient. It is essential that you hire a personal injury lawyer to help you obtain the compensation you're entitled to.

Most car accident attorneys handle cases on a contingency basis. This means that the attorney won't be paid until the case is resolved. Instead the attorney receives a percentage of the award. The percentage of the award varies by state and is often set at a specific amount. It's important to note, though, that attorney fees differ from costs. The client might also have to pay for certain out-of-pocket expenses.
